Fibromyalgia (FM or FMS) is a disorder of unknown origin,which causes chronic pain and allodynia (a heightened and painful response to pressure) over various parts of the body. However,fibromyalgia,is not restricted to pain and therefore may be classified as fibromyalgia syndrome. There are nine paired tender points that comprise the 1990 American College of Rheumatology criteria for fibromyalgia. Pictured here are the five posterior ones | |
